Browse Source

allow to send a message only if their was a initial contact request #168

pull/179/head
DenioD 4 years ago
parent
commit
ec5a88aafd
  1. 2
      src/Chat/Chat.cpp
  2. 4
      src/mainwindow.cpp
  3. 3188
      src/mainwindow.ui

2
src/Chat/Chat.cpp

@ -126,7 +126,7 @@ void Chat::renderChatBox(Ui::MainWindow *ui, QListView *view, QLabel *label)
Items1->setData(INCOMING, Qt::UserRole + 1); Items1->setData(INCOMING, Qt::UserRole + 1);
chat->appendRow(Items1); chat->appendRow(Items1);
ui->listChat->setModel(chat); ui->listChat->setModel(chat);
ui->memoTxtChat->setEnabled(true);
} }
else else

4
src/mainwindow.cpp

@ -92,7 +92,7 @@ MainWindow::MainWindow(QWidget *parent) :
} }
ui->memoTxtChat->setAutoFillBackground(false); ui->memoTxtChat->setAutoFillBackground(false);
ui->memoTxtChat->setPlaceholderText("Send Message"); ui->memoTxtChat->setPlaceholderText("Send Message (you can only write messages after the initial message from your contact)");
ui->memoTxtChat->setTextColor(Qt::white); ui->memoTxtChat->setTextColor(Qt::white);
// Status Bar // Status Bar
@ -1613,7 +1613,7 @@ void MainWindow::setupchatTab() {
ui->listContactWidget->addAction(HushAction); ui->listContactWidget->addAction(HushAction);
ui->listContactWidget->addAction(editAction); ui->listContactWidget->addAction(editAction);
ui->listContactWidget->addAction(subatomicAction); ui->listContactWidget->addAction(subatomicAction);
ui->memoTxtChat->setEnabled(true); ui->memoTxtChat->setEnabled(false);
QModelIndex index = ui->listContactWidget->currentIndex(); QModelIndex index = ui->listContactWidget->currentIndex();
QString label_contact = index.data(Qt::DisplayRole).toString(); QString label_contact = index.data(Qt::DisplayRole).toString();

3188
src/mainwindow.ui

File diff suppressed because it is too large
Loading…
Cancel
Save